One Stop Systems to Report Fourth Quarter 2025 Financial Results
Rhea-AI Summary
One Stop Systems (Nasdaq: OSS) will report fourth quarter 2025 financial results before the market opens on Wednesday, March 18, 2026. A webcast and conference call will be held the same day at 10:00 a.m. ET to review the company’s results.

Over the last few months, OSS has reported several growth-focused developments. On Jan 7 (news_id 954095), a new U.S. defense prime partnership and ~$1.2M pre-production order saw shares rise 22.2%. A multi-year aerospace platform award on Jan 27 (news_id 1003901) lifted the stock 3.85%. February brought AFCEA West product exposure (4.44% move) and substantial P-8A Poseidon awards with a 26.23% jump, while a new commercial robotics customer modestly pressured shares (-0.74%). About One Stop Systems
One Stop Systems, Inc. (Nasdaq: OSS) is a leader in AI enabled solutions for the demanding 'edge'. OSS designs and manufactures Enterprise Class compute and storage products that enable rugged AI, sensor fusion and autonomous capabilities without compromise. These hardware and software platforms bring the latest data center performance to harsh and challenging applications, whether they are on land, sea or in the air.
OSS products include ruggedized servers, compute accelerators, flash storage arrays, and storage acceleration software. These specialized compact products are used across multiple industries and applications, including autonomous trucking and farming, as well as aircraft, drones, ships and vehicles within the defense industry.
OSS solutions address the entire AI workflow, from high-speed data acquisition to deep learning, training and large-scale inference, and have delivered many industry firsts for industrial OEM and government customers.
